The AC didn't work and so we couldn't get any heating. We ended up having to warm ourselves with a hair dryer. The water in the bathroom wasn't warm, let alone hot, and it made it difficult to attempt taking a shower in the freezing cold. We called the front desk for help and all they did was let the water run for almost 20 minutes and then claimed it was warm. We tried the water out after the attendant left and realized the water was still cold. There were some stains on our sheets which was disconcerting. In the morning, we also found a few flies that we tried to swat, which ended up attracting more; we later found a swarm of flies in the crannies of the curtain rod, and we had to call the front desk again to kill them. They also did not have any currency available to provide us with exchanged money, so we had to settle with eating the cheapest dal and rice, which was surprisingly delicious, so i'll give them that. The morning breakfast however was disappointing with rock cold potatoes and very few options in general. Just a 2 star for location. Well, our family went here in Bhaitika. We booked two rooms for our families, one suite room and due to availability issues there was no suite room available. So we went for deluxe room. I don't know where to began. The hotel staffs seriously lacks demeanor! They were so rude. One such instances was during dinner where we were offered a 4 chair table for dinner (we were six in total with two children aged 9 and 6). When asked upon the staffs rudely showed us the table and simply said "tya gayera basnus". The food wasn't that great. The vegetable soup and grilled chicken was good though. The head restaurant staff was times and again hovering around the tourists and asking them about the food and offering them drink options. Not once did he come to our table. I asked where the plates were and same response he pointed his hands and rudely said "u tya cha dekhnu bhayena". Breakfast was okay! They had this delicious potato and green peas curry. I particularly felt that he was more inclined towards serving the tourists than internal tourists. Talking about the room. The deluxe room was way too small. The room was moldy, the bed sheets were damp, the pillow smelled like a mixture of hair oil and someone else's shampoo. Suite room was okay. But the same moldy smell, damp towels. Over all the experience was bad staying in this room. The children's were so bored. They have actually nothing to do. No entertainment. The only good thing about this place was the resident manager who kept asking how we felt, how the food was and how were we doing.

Undoubtedly, the sunrise we experienced in this hotel stands out as the most breathtaking one we've ever witnessed. Opting for a room with a view turned out to be an exceptionally wise decision. The sunrise, casting its hues on the Great Himalayan Langtang Range, painted a memory of a lifetime. The property itself offers a premium ambiance, with its prime location justifying the higher fare. Fortunately, the facilities and experiences offered lived up to our expectations, making the expense seem entirely justified. The room, catering to a couple's needs, was generously spacious, featuring a comfortable bed and a well-equipped washroom. The balcony, charmingly romantic and adequately sized, provided an ideal spot for couples or families to relish the panoramic views. Additionally, the breakfast offered was satisfying. The on-site restaurant boasted both quality and reasonable prices. We had lunch, dinner, and evening coffee, savoring each dish. The open-air seating area added to the charm, even though weather conditions limited our clear view—it was an experience in itself. In summary, our overnight stay at this hotel crafted a truly memorable experience.
